OverviewFire Wet Systems TechnicianLocation: Adelaide, SA (and wider SA as required) | Company: BGIS (Technical Services), Self-Perform Contract | Employment Type: Full-Time, Permanent, Mobile RoleThe RoleWe're seeking a skilled Fire Wet Systems Technician to join our Adelaide team.
You'll provide service, maintenance, and installation of wet fire systems and associated firefighting equipment in line with AS1851-2012.
This mobile role covers a diverse range of client sites across healthcare, aviation, retail, and government, ensuring assets remain safe, compliant, and reliable.Why You'll Love Working With BGISCompany vehicle – contemporary fleet with tolls, fuel & insurance coveredStrong wages + yearly increases, RDOs, overtime & on-call allowanceCareer growth – paid training (EWP, First Aid, Working at Heights & more)Top-Tier Equipment Provided – iPad, phone, uniforms & PPE to be job-ready from day oneRecognition & rewards – spot vouchers + $2,000 referral bonusDiscounts on a wide range of products & servicesPaid parental leave & paid volunteer leaveSafe systems, supportive team & clear pathways for promotionWhat You'll Be DoingMaintain, install, and service all wet fire systems and firefighting equipmentConduct inspections, testing, and servicing of wet fire assets to AS1851-2012Perform alterations to existing wet fire systems as requiredPrepare accurate customer quotations and identify remedial workProvide technical advice to clients and technicians where neededSupport with inspections and servicing of portable fire equipment (as required)Complete rectification notes and compliance records via BGIS systemsBuild strong working relationships with clients, subcontractors, and consultantsYour Education, Experience & SkillsCertificate III in Fire Protection (Sprinkler Fitter) or equivalent (mandatory)White Card (mandatory)Proven experience servicing, maintaining, and installing wet fire systemsStrong knowledge of AS1851 and AS2118 standards (essential)Ability to prepare quotes, identify remedial works, and liaise with clientsExcellent stakeholder communication and customer service skillsFull working rights in Australia (essential)About BGISBGIS Technical Services is the hands-on trades and maintenance division of BGIS — delivering safe, reliable, and efficient technical services for clients across Australia.
